Are you sure the “DR Data Domain” is mounted where you’re doing the duplications?   If for some reason it weren’t you might be writing into and filling up a filesystem other than the one you think you are. 

 

Is this an NFS mount?

 

What is the storage unit defined as for the host that is doing  the duplications?

Duplication jobs are failing with a 129, insufficient space on our DR Data Domain.

We have over 17tb of free space at least.

What is causing this?

Backups are running fine. Dup jobs to our production Data Domain are fine.
